A global energy company is seeking an IT Application/System Specialist to manage Microsoft System Center Configuration Manager (SCCM) within their Computer Operations Department. The role involves administering Windows Server Operating Systems and generating performance reports.
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science and a minimum of 5 years experience in system administration, including expertise in SCCM and SQL.
The company offers a unique environment for professional growth with substantial investment in technology.
